    Which was likely prompted by the strengthening of the YEN compared to USD. It has fallen from ~120 yen (+/- daily/weekly/monthly variance) per USD down to ~100 yen per USD. IE - it requires more USD to provide a similar amount of revenue in terms of YEN. That will be important for their financial reports as a stronger YEN compared to USD will negatively impact revenue from that region.

    Of course, the benefit is that if the YEN weakens versus the dollar at some later date, they won't reverse that change. Hence it'll provide a significant revenue boost with Sony having to do nothing at that point. And since it basically just brings the price for PSN on par with Xbox Gold in that region, there should be little to no backlash to it.

    The slim power supply input label is 220-240v @ 0.8A
    In comparison the PS4 fat power supply was 100-240 @ 2.5A

    Making it somewhere around a 175W power supply specs... If they designed with similar margins for efficiency, the ballpark would be 105W peak versus the fat peaking at 151W (from it's 250W PS).
